WHEREAS, the Junior League of Corpus Christi, Texas and the Corpus Christi Arts Council have formulated plans for the Bayfest '77 to be held on Friday, September 30 through Sunday, October 2, 1977; and WHEREAS, the purpose of said Bayfest '77 is to feature festival -type booths and entertaining programs sponsored by numerous Corpus Christi Civic Clubs and other organizations; and WHEREAS, the proceeds from the Bayfest will be used for community and civic projects; and WHEREAS, the Junior League of Corpus Christi, Texas and the Corpus Christi Arts Council have requested that from 8:00 A.M. Saturday, September 24, 1977, to 12:00 Noon Wednesday, October 5, 1977, the 1200 through 1700 blocks of N. Chaparral Blvd. be closed to vehicular traffic; and WHEREAS, numerous civic and community groups will participate in the Bayfest and have endorsed it; and WHEREAS, the City Council finds that the proposed Bayfest will be in the interests of the public welfare; N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F CORPUS CHRISTI, TEXAS: SECTION 1. That vehicular traffic be barred from the 1200 through 1700 blocks of N. Shoreline Blvd. (both directions of travel) from 8:00 A.M. Saturday, September 24, 1977, to 12:00 Noon Wednesday, October 5, 1977, so that the Junior WOMBED ED 'JUL 0 7 1 ^20 13820 e League of Corpus Christi, Texas and the Corpus Christi Arts`Council can co- sponsor a Bayfest '77, and that said areas be barricaded to through traffic. It is directed that said areas be barricaded so as to allow emergency vehicles such as Fire, Police and Ambulance vehicles to enter said areas in case of an emergency. It is further provided that vehicles of the City or Utility Companies furnishing public utilities, such as electricity, gas, water and telephone service to said areas be permitted to enter said areas in case of emergency. SECTION 2. That in maintaining the streets closed by this ordinance, the following regulations shall be observed: A. Liability insurance shall be furnished free of cost to the City, protecting against liability to the public. Such insurance shall have policy limits of at least $100,000 personal injury up to $300,000 per accident, and $50,000 property damage, and shall name the City of Corpus Christi, Texas, the Junior League of Corpus Christi, Texas, and the Corpus Christi Arts Council as insureds. A Certificate of Insurance in the above amounts shall be furnished the Citv Secretary and approved by the Citv Attornev with the application and permit provided for hereinafter. B. Any damage to City property will be restored by the sponsors of the aforesaid Bayfest promptly after the close of the Bayfest. Such restoration liability shall not exceed $500. C. Any activities involving the use of the seawall, marina or barge dock must be approved by the Community Enrichment Director. D. Any work which involves holes or other changes in the pavement, curbs, sidewalks, seawall or barge dock must be approved by the Engineering 5 Physical Development Director and no such approval may be given if the work will require repair by the City. E. Appropriate permits must be obtained from the Alcoholic Beverage Commission for the sale of beer and the City- County Health Department for the sale of food. F. The construction work for displays within the areas affected by this ordinance shall be conducted in accordance with City specifications and in accordance with the electrical, plumbing and building construction codes of the City and after furnishing adequate assurance "that all damages will be remedied by the permittee. -2- G. No paint or markings shall be permitted which in any way obliterates or defaces any pavement markings heretofore existing for the guidance of any motor vehicle. H. After the Bayfest ends, the sponsor will see that the street is cleaned and restored to a condition to allow vehicular traffic to return to the streets at the expiration of the closure of the streets.
